Predict the output of following Java Program
class Grandparent {
public void Print() {
System.out.println( "Grandparent's Print()" );
}
}
class Parent extends Grandparent {
public void Print() {
System.out.println( "Parent's Print()" );
}
}
class Child extends Parent {
public void Print() {
super . super .Print();
System.out.println( "Child's Print()" );
}
}
public class Main {
public static void main(String[] args) {
Child c = new Child();
c.Print();
}
}
|
(A) Compiler Error in super.super.Print()
(B)
Grandparent's Print()
Parent's Print()
Child's Print()
(C) Runtime Error
Answer: (A)
Explanation: In Java, it is not allowed to do super.super. We can only access Grandparent’s members using Parent. For example, the following program works fine.
// Guess the output
// filename Main.java
class Grandparent {
public void Print() {
System.out.println("Grandparent's Print()");
}
}
class Parent extends Grandparent {
public void Print() {
super.Print();
System.out.println("Parent's Print()");
}
}
class Child extends Parent {
public void Print() {
super.Print();
System.out.println("Child's Print()");
}
}
class Main {
public static void main(String[] args) {
Child c = new Child();
c.Print();
}
}
